Tight is not always right. Just play your game the way you feel comfortable. Adapting & adjusting are key factors here. The way to play against, "donks" AKA poor players depends a lot on stacks, blinds & position. Donks will have a looser than usual hand range so use that to your advantage & exploit that. Proceed with caution on low & drawing boards if you have a tight range and have completely missed the board. Avoid getting into HUGE pots with mediocre hands. Play when possible in position so you can gather more info on future streets. Also, pick your spots.
